An object is placed at a concave mirror's center of curvature. The image produced by the mirror is located

A)

out beyond the center of curvature.
B)

at the center of curvature.
C)

between the center of curvature and the focal point.
D)

at the focal point.
E)

between the focal point and the surface of the mirror.


B
